Transaction 632c2294983d48b2d947aa962b971cfb76fb0aa9ea5d8eacb51f8302f199ce60

4 Input
1 Outputs
  • 632c2294983d48b2d947aa962b971cfb76fb0aa9ea5d8eacb51f8302f199ce60:0
  • value  38527004
    address  1H49QEypGmGdzYF946qfB8HEh5SA1x9EmK